The UK's planning system needs a more adaptive approach within the National Planning Policy Framework (NPPF) to effectively address climate change and achieve net zero goals. Without significant reform, it risks continuing to undermine climate efforts and fail to protect communities from extreme weather.

Aether contributed to an analysis of procurement (scope 3) emissions reporting in the Scottish public sector, as summarised in this ClimateXChange report for the Scottish Government. This report aims to demonstrate approaches and tools available to Scottish public bodies to understand and report their supply chain emissions and provide options for action to improve supply chain reporting across the public sector.

The upcoming guidance for quantitative carbon reporting (QCR) within Local Transport Plan 4 will require authorities to estimate current and predict future carbon emissions from their transport plans. For elected members, chief executives and sectoral directors the LTP 4 period will mark a golden opportunity to use climate data to support decision making on a larger set of growth challenges such as cost of living, aging populations, levelling up, and spiralling health problems.

Actions to mitigate climate change often have wider social, economic and environmental impacts. These impacts can be both positive and negative. Aether has compiled a wider impacts database for climate actions with matrices to show the interlinkages.
